Nutrition Lecture with Dr. Greger in Burke, VA. (May 12, 2009)
On Tuesday, May 12, 2009, COK hosted a special nutrition event at the Burke Library featuring Dr. Michael Greger from The Humane Society of the United States. Dr. Greger shared the latest in peer-reviewed research to show that the healthiest diet is also the most humane. Using a quiz-show format, he kept the audience entertained while also educating them about the benefits of a plant-based diet. Over 50 people came to the lecture and enjoyed a free vegan meal. Community members, a local boot camp workout group, and even COK's own intern were surprised to discover how some of their favorite foods stacked up on the nutrition scale.
